Descriptions of Databases & Electronic Services
  • iBorrow - Search for library materials throughout the Tampa Bay Area, and place your own requests to have items sent to the library most convenient to you
  • Auto Repair Reference Center - Search for repair procedures, wiring diagrams, recalls, and more for your vehicle
  • eBooks - Browse through and read thousands of full-text electronic books available on any Internet-access computer, anytime you need them (after creating an account at a library)
  • FirstSearch - Search in WorldCat, a database of library materials throughout the United States and a several other countries
  • GaleNet - Find information in the following databases made available by the Pinellas Public Library Cooperative and the State Library of Florida:
    • Biography Resource Center - biographical information on thousands of famous or influential people
    • Business & Company Resource Center - detailed company and industry news and information
    • Computer Database - news, reviews, and articles related to computer technology
    • Expanded Academic ASAP - articles from scholarly journals, news magazines, and newspapers covering many academic disciplines
    • General Business File ASAP - information on companies, industry, and management
    • General Reference Center Gold - articles on a wide variety of topics
    • Health & Wellness Resource Center - articles and information on health-related topics, including alternative medicine
    • Health Reference Center Academic - articles on many health-related topics
    • Informe - Una colección de revistas hispánicas con textos completos. Abarca negocios, salud, tecnología, cultura, temas de actualidad y otras materias
    • InfoTrac OneFile - millions of full-text articles on a wide range of general-interest topics
    • Junior Edition - a database of articles designed for research at the junior high/middle school level, using the traditional look of the InfoTrac database
    • Junior Edition-K12 - the Junior Edition database with an easier-to-use design
    • Kid's Edition - a database of articles designed for research at the elementary school level, using the traditional look of the InfoTrac database
    • Kid's Edition-K12 - the Kid's Edition database with an easier-to-use design
    • Literature Resource Center - articles and information on literature-related topics
    • Professional Collection - journal articles designed to meet the information needs of educators, administrators, and many other professionals
    • Student Edition - a database of articles designed for research at the high school level, using the traditional look of the InfoTrac database
    • Student Edition - the Student Edition database with an easier-to-use design
    • What Do I Read Next? - a resource designed to help you find books suited to your individual tastes or needs
  • LearnATest - Practice online for various academic and professional tests
  • NewsBank - Find and read articles from the St. Petersburg Times as far back as 1987 (Note: additional newspapers are available on this database from within the library)
  • ReferenceUSA - Business and residential information databases
